ASUS’ ProArt range provides creators with a stable foundation for their inspiration. Their new ASUS ProArt GeForce RTX 5090 features a Double Flow Through graphics card design, first pioneered by NVIDIA, and now being introduced in partners’ cards. It features multiple advanced PCBs to provide double the airflow of a traditional graphics card layout. And its dimensions make it an SFF-Ready Enthusiast GeForce Card, so you can pack high performance into a smaller footprint chassis.
GIGABYTE’s AORUS GeForce RTX 5090 INFINITY packs a lot of power into a premium design. The WINDFORCE Hyperburst Cooling System features the Double Flow Through design, plus GIGABYTE’s patented Hawk fans, superconducting heat pipes, and a direct-touch vapor chamber for incredible cooling performance. This card comes equipped with a “overdrive fan”, for extra cooling performance when you’re running extreme workloads. It also has a beautiful RGB Halo - a striking feature for showcasing your build and system.
MSI is bringing back the LIGHTNING series with the GeForce RTX 5090 LIGHTNING Z which is designed for users wanting maximum performance. A custom PCB design with a dedicated high-power architecture enables the MSI GeForce RTX 5090 LIGHTNING Z to extract every ounce of performance from the GPU. To keep the card cool when running at full load, the card has a hybrid liquid cooling system. And to easily monitor temperatures and other information, there’s a built in 8-inch LCD screen display.
PNY’s GeForce RTX 5080 Dual-Fan Slim graphics card is one of the smallest RTX 5080 models on the market. With its 120mm fans, an advanced vapor chamber, and a highly optimized industrial design for airflow, it brings high gaming performance to your system - perfect for most mATX chassis. PNY has also announced GeForce RTX 5070 Ti Dual-Fan Slim and GeForce RTX 5070 Dual-Fan Slim models, for the same great innovations at a variety of price points.

Today, the next generation of G-SYNC begins with the launch of G-SYNC Pulsar, the latest evolution of our pioneering VRR technology. G-SYNC Pulsar delivers a stutter-free experience with buttery smooth motion, and a new gold standard for visual clarity and fidelity through the invention of variable frequency backlight strobing.
G-SYNC Pulsar displays from Acer, AOC, ASUS and MSI will be available starting January 7th, 6AM PT, at select retailers, with additional retailers and units coming over the following weeks.
Each includes our new G-SYNC Ambient Adaptive Technology, enabling color temperature and brightness to be automatically tuned for optimal viewing at any hour of the day or night.
All four displays feature a 27 inch 2560x1440 IPS display that runs at a 360Hz refresh rate, with 500 nits of peak brightness in HDR. Our new G-SYNC Pulsar displays are also the first to be built in collaboration with MediaTek, enabling G-SYNC technologies to be incorporated directly into the display scaler, bypassing the need for dedicated G-SYNC modules. This streamlines production, making G-SYNC more accessible for monitor manufacturers, helping us bring G-SYNC technologies and displays to more consumers faster than ever before.
Additionally, in our new GeForce Game Ready Driver, our team has validated another 63 G-SYNC Compatible displays, including new 2026 TV models from LG and Samsung, and new monitors.
G-SYNC Compatible displays deliver a baseline Variable Refresh Rate (VRR) experience that’s been validated by our G-SYNC team, making gaming smoother and more enjoyable. G-SYNC Compatible VRR is available on hundreds of monitors and TVs from leading manufacturers, in all sizes and at all price points, giving GeForce users a ton of choice when searching for a display.
On the list, there’s support for the new 27-inch G-SYNC Compatible Samsung Odyssey G60H monitor, the world’s first 1,040Hz dual mode competitive gaming display.
And support for the ASUS ROG Strix 5K XG27JCG, a 27-inch, 180Hz, Fast IPS 5120x2880 (5K) display, with 218 pixels per inch, the highest of any G-SYNC Compatible display, for users seeking super sharp images and detail. And for gamers wanting faster response times and refresh rates in competitive titles, the XG27JCG can switch to a 2560x1440 330Hz mode.

The new customizable CyberPowerPC MA-01 PC integrates performance-focused engineering with a cohesive, mid-century-modern minimalist design. Sculpted internal vents conceal fans and cables while directing airflow efficiently away from heat-critical components.
A woven stainless-steel mesh top reduces high-frequency noise by up to 30 percent without restricting ventilation and a multi-piece intake cover hides fan blades while delivering targeted cooling to the GPU and CPU cooler. Consistent geometry, concealed fasteners, and ATX-standard compatibility ensure a clean look and long-term usability.
The Trace X system focuses on maximum compatibility while emphasizing aesthetics with a metallic front grill and a built-in flowing vent design that wraps around the top and back side panel. The chassis can support GPUs up to 415 mm long, power supplies up to 230 mm long and air coolers up to 165mm tall along with 8 spots for 120mm fans for optimal cooling performance. The case also comes with an optional ARBG lighting kit controlled by the motherboard adding to its stylish fashion.
The NEURON 4500X, a panoramic, wrap-around, glass mid-tower system is all-new for 2026. Built on the FRAME Modular Case System, it supports reverse-connector motherboards, 360mm radiators AIO, and up to seven fans for powerful cooling.
